🌍 Climate Rules Are Starting to Change How Businesses Operate

Sustainability is no longer just about “being environmentally friendly.”

Around the world, new climate rules and reporting requirements are starting to affect:
• trade
• exports
• supply chains
• energy costs
• business funding
For many businesses, this creates both pressure and opportunity.

Here are 3 major shifts happening right now:
🔹 Companies are being asked to prove their environmental impact with real data
🔹 Buyers and investors are paying more attention to climate risks and supply chain transparency
🔹 Renewable energy and efficient operations are becoming important for long-term cost savings and resilience

📱 Is your business "Digital-Ready"?

Sustainability in 2026 isn't just for big corporations. Small businesses can use simple digital tools to save big on energy and waste!

• Smart Energy:
Using a simple smart plug and app can help you identify "energy vampires" in your shop, saving up to 15% on your monthly bill.

• Digital Receipts:
Stop the paper waste and start building your customer database at the same time.

• Local Sourcing:
Use digital marketplaces to find local suppliers, reducing your shipping costs and carbon footprint in one go!

Practical Tip: Spend 30 minutes this week auditing your digital tools. Are they helping you save time and energy?

🌍 Why net zero depends on Scope 3

Many businesses are realising that the biggest part of their carbon footprint sits outside their own operations. That means suppliers, logistics, purchased products and customer use all matter.

That’s why Scope 3 is becoming central to climate strategy:
🔹 It often represents the largest share of emissions
🔹 Regulations now require value chain transparency
🔹 Real reductions depend on supplier collaboration

For organisations, this means net zero is no longer just about internal efficiency — it’s about transforming how supply chains operate.
